Organizational Climate MotivesAchievementExpert InfluenceExtensionControlDependencyAffiliation

Page 3: Impact of organizational motives on organizational climate

AchievementCharacterized by :

Concern for excellenceCompetition in terms of standardsSetting of challenging goalsAwareness of the obstacles in

achieving goalsPersistence in trying alternative

paths to one’s goals

Achievement Industrial and Business Organizations

Page 4: Impact of organizational motives on organizational climate

Expert InfluenceCharacterized by :

Making an impact on othersDesire to make people do what one

thinks is rightUrge to change situationsDevelop people

Expert Influence University Departments and Scientific Organizations

Page 5: Impact of organizational motives on organizational climate

Extension

Characterized by :Concern for othersInterest in super ordinate goalsUrge to be relevant and useful to large groups including society

Extension Community Service Organizations

Page 6: Impact of organizational motives on organizational climate

ControlCharacterized by :

Concern for OrderlinessDesire to be informedUrge to monitor eventsTake corrective action

when neededNeed to display personal power

Control Bureaucracies such as Govt. Depts. and Agencies

Page 7: Impact of organizational motives on organizational climate

DependencyCharacterized by :

Assistance of others in developing oneselfNeed to check with significant othersTendency to submit ideas for approvalUrge to maintain relationship based on other person’s approval

Dependency Traditional or Autocratic Organizations

Page 8: Impact of organizational motives on organizational climate

Affiliation

Characterized by :Concern for maintaining and establishing close personal relationshipsEmphasis on friendshipTendency to express one’s emotions

Affiliation Clubs
